本試驗調配四組水溶性防火藥劑,以眞空加壓方式注入合板,期能製造符合國家標準CNS-6532規定之室內裝飾用耐燃合板。試驗結果得知防火劑注入處理之合板,其抗燃性以自行調配之FR防火劑者效果最好,其次為防火劑AF及Dricon;再次為Bi-fax。FR防火劑以20%重量百分率水溶液處理,合板厚度10mm以上者均可符合CNS-6532耐燃三級之要求,且其發熱量(tdθ)及發煙量(C(下標 A))亦較其他三組配方低,餘燄時間(tl)亦較短。防火劑AF抗燃效果,其著火性(tc)及發熱量均可達CNS-6532耐燃三級之要求,合板厚度12mm以上之餘燄時間未超過30sec,惟其發煙量偏高有待克服。而以Dricon防火劑處理之合板,其著火性、發熱量亦均可達CNS-6532耐燃三級之要求,惟其餘燄時間均超過30sec,故僅適合處理厚度15mm以上之合板。防火劑Bio-fax雖然具有低發煙量之特性,但因其自熄性(即餘燄時間)較差,故除了以20%濃度處理15mm厚之合板外,均無法符合CNS-6532耐燃三級之要求。至於合板處理前後之顏色變化,Dricon處理材變化最小,△E*為2.21,其次為FR處理材,△E*為3.84,而Bio-fax及AF處理材之顏色變化最大,△E*分別為10.76及12.670。
Water-soluble fire retardants, including AP, Bio-fax, Dricon and FR, were impregnated into plywood with vacuum pressure treatment to increase its incombustibility. A building material- combustibility-tester (model P2-RE3 from Toyoseki, Japan) and Chinese National Standards CNS6532 were used to evaluate the incombustibility of plywood. The results revealed that the order of decreasing incombustibility is: FR, AF, Dricon, Bio-fax. The plywood which was thicker than 10 mm and treated with FR 20% (wt/wt) water solution met the Grade 3 standard of CNS-6532. Its heat generation and fuming were less than those of the other 3 fire retardants. Its after flaming was also shorter. The incombustibility of AP met the requirement of the Grade.3 standard of CNS-6532. The after flaming of AP-treated plywood thicker than 12mm was shorter than 30s. However, the excessive value of fuming needs improving. The ignitability and heat generation of Dricon fire-retardant-treated plywood met the requirement of the Grade 3 standard of CNS-6532. The after flaming of Dricon-treated plywood was longer than 30s, so that Dricon is just suited for use with flame-resistant plywood thicker than 15 mm. Although Bio-fax treated plywood had low-fuming characters, its after flaming was the worst. Bio-fax-treated plywood did not meet the requirement of the Grade 3 standard of CNS-6532 except for the 15 mm-thick plywood which was treated with a 20% solution. Color differences (△E*) of plywood treated with the 4 fire retardants were 2.21, 3.84, 10.76, and 12.67 for Dricon, FR, Bio-fax, and AF, respectively.
